The Portside Challenge: Defending Materials Against Coastal Marine Chlorides Sourcing industrial tower packing for installation near major seaports requires balancing capital expenditure (CAPEX) against long-term mechanical survival. Portside industrial zones experience high atmospheric humidity saturated with marine chlorides (salt spray). When standard, unverified metals are exposed to this combination, it triggers rapid micro-scale pitting, crevice corrosion, and chloride-induced stress corrosion cracking. If these compromised materials are installed inside a vertical column shell, they suffer from rapid material thinning and premature failure. To eliminate validation and structural risks for coastal Vietnamese operators, Aera Engineering enforces complete metallurgical traceability from raw coil to finished cargo. Every single export batch is paired with a comprehensive data pack: Mill Test Certificates (MTC): Providing full chemical composition logs and heat numbers traceable back to the original raw coil source. Positive Material Identification (PMI): Non-destructive X-ray verification executed via handheld XRF analyzers to guarantee exact alloy formulation (such as verifying the mandatory 2–3% Molybdenum requirement in Stainless Steel 316L to resist chloride pitting). 3. High-Performance Mass Transfer Solutions for Fast Turnarounds Aera Engineering utilizes advanced internal tooling and automated progressive stamping dies at our manufacturing hub to press high-efficiency random packings with absolute dimensional uniformity. This strict manufacturing control ensures that every element resists element nesting (interlocking under deep-bed weights), eliminating the risk of liquid channeling and premature column flooding. Our maritime export inventory for Vietnam includes: Aera Saddles (Metal IMTP Equivalents): Combining the low-drag aerodynamic profile of a saddle with the high-efficiency internal tabs of a ring. Featuring an exceptionally open profile, they achieve up to a 30% reduction in operating pressure drop (dP) and highly minimized HETP (Height Equivalent to a Theoretical Plate). Aera P-Rings (Pall Rings): The industry's most dependable cylindrical upgrade over solid-walled Raschig rings, utilizing internally projecting fingers to maximize liquid film contact across standard absorption and stripping lines. Corrugated Structured Packing: Fabricated from thin, corrugated metal sheets or woven wire gauzes arranged in geometric blocks. Providing minimal resistance to vapor flow, it represents the absolute standard for high-vacuum distillation columns, keeping base operating temperatures low to prevent thermal cracking. 4. Sea-Worthy Preservation Packing and Logistics Control Tower packing elements feature delicate geometric wall profiles (ranging from 0.2 mm to 1.0 mm) that are highly sensitive to physical deformation and marine salt spray during ocean transit. Loose dumping can lead to crushed elements, altering the bed's void fraction post-installation.
